Kvanttiloukut
Kvanttiloukut, sometimes translated as quantum traps or quantum locks, refers to a concept in quantum mechanics describing phenomena where a quantum system is confined to a specific region of space or a particular state. This confinement can be achieved through various physical means, such as potential barriers or engineered electromagnetic fields. Unlike classical confinement, which is easily understood through everyday experience, quantum confinement arises from the wave-like nature of particles at the atomic and subatomic level.
